Output 56ed11082c305a196da62c00a3ea5b751bfc0e309aaa149d51d419f2f427e36a:1

value
17046
script pubkey
OP_0 OP_PUSHBYTES_20 3a27124eebf150188ccd0cfbc09f62901fd36684
address
bc1q8gn3ynht79gp3rxdpnaup8mzjq0axe5y3gazfm
transaction
56ed11082c305a196da62c00a3ea5b751bfc0e309aaa149d51d419f2f427e36a
confirmations
51575
spent
true